Output 50e9ec7d84894510694ff4ecb2f07c295306cac40b243789b2bf6c7a7be0ea0a:0

value
105144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f10904eb63b50791a97dd0f94d7f42de124bf376 OP_EQUAL
address
3PfVaSXx6nXJqCte7KFEQs2DuwjQmjgqNc
transaction
50e9ec7d84894510694ff4ecb2f07c295306cac40b243789b2bf6c7a7be0ea0a
spent
true